Sammy and Bob have been busy traveling to several industry conferences this fall. In this episode of Wealthy Behavior, Heritage Financial CEO, Sammy Azzouz, and CIO, Bob Weisse, continue last month’s discussion sharing takeaways from conferences and conversations with industry leaders. While some concerns from recent months have subsided, others remain. Inflation, Treasury yields, and the risk of a recession are what most investors are focused on today. Hear Bob’s thoughts on what he’s confident in, what he’s watching for, and what concerns him the most. They also discuss:• The difference between TIPS and I Bonds• Why stocks and bonds have been moving in tandem with one another• Views on indexing vs. active management, and some of the perils of indexingOur Fall Market Outlook webinar addressed many of these topics as well as our expectations for the future.
